First off, i’m from New England, not from the area. Stopped here around 6:45pm on a Friday night. Great looking place from the outside, and I personally loved the name. Went in, they have a massive rectangle bar with multiple TVs to view no matter where you sit. There has to be at least 50 seats at the bar alone. They have pool tables, a ton of high tops, and the place looks like it would be a great nightlife spot on a Friday or Saturday after 10pm I would guess. They give you a chilled glass every single time you get a new beer from the tap which I loved. I got the buffalo mac and cheese and it was amazing.
The waitresses and bartenders are all super kind and very will have a really kind conversation with you. They all wear these green one piece thong suits as their uniform, which may be a draw for some and a deterrent for others.
Overall, I would go back to this place 10+ more times, I loved it.
